Water Efficiency and Sustainability

In South Africa, a single building can waste thousands of litres daily to unnoticed leaks, turning every meter of pipe into a moral ledger of waste. A rigorous approach to water efficiency elevates the plumber work list from maintenance to strategic stewardship, shaping choices that satisfy clients and search engines alike.

Measurable steps focus on flow-conscious design and durability. The core elements of the water efficiency portion of the plumber work list include:

  • low-flow fixtures and fittings to curb everyday consumption
  • pressure management and rapid leak detection
  • retrofitting opportunities and smart metering to track consumption
